A+B=120 eq. 1 B+C=50 eq. 2 C+A=110 eq. 3 =》 from eq. 1 A=120-B Substituting the value (A=120-B) in eq. 3 we get, C+(120-B)=110 C=B-10 Substituting the value ( C=B-10 ) in eq. 2 we get, B+(B-10)=50 2B=50+10 B=30
